Is NOS car illegal?

In the United States, at the federal level, nitrous oxide (NOS) is not illegal to use in cars. However, laws regulating NOS use can vary from state to state. In Maryland, for example, any vehicle equipped with a power booster system must have a specific decal identifying its use to drive it on a highway.

Does NOS increase top speed?

In the nitrous oxide molecule the atoms are boud together, so the oxygen is not free but the bond breaks down as temperature rises (arround 565° F). When you add nitrous oxide to an engine, the total amount of oxygen is increased while the volume of nitrogen is decreased. This increase will speed up the burn process.

Why is Nos illegal in UK?

Nitrous oxide is normally treated as a “psychoactive substance” under the Psychoactive Substances Act 2016. Producing, supplying and importing/ exporting psychoactive substances for human consumption is illegal.

How long will a 10 pound bottle of nitrous last?

On the 75hp setting, a 10 lb. bottle will last around 10 quarter mile runs. On the 125hp setting the bottle will last around 6 runs.

Is laughing gas illegal in America?

Under United States federal law, possession of nitrous oxide is legal and is not subject to DEA purview. It is, however, regulated by the Food and Drug Administration under the Food Drug and Cosmetics Act.

Why do you purge nitrous?

The purpose of a nitrous purge is to ensure that the correct amount of nitrous oxide is delivered the moment the system is activated as nitrous and fuel jets are sized to produce correct air / fuel ratios, and as liquid nitrous is denser than gaseous nitrous, any nitrous vapor in the lines will cause the car to "bog" ...
